As a woman, I looked and looked for a woman's coat that I could use for walking my dogs in the cold rainy weather. Women's coats often just do not have enough pockets or features. So I decided to start looking for men's coats. This one is great. It's super warm, blocks the wind, has a ton of pockets and a great hood. It is a big roomy and the sleeves are a little too long, as expected, but I like the roomy feel and just roll the sleeves up a bit. So glad I have this for cold windy mornings. ... show more

I have been looking for a winter jacket for a while now, but didn't want to spend a ton of money. I saw this jacket and the 3 in 1 aspect piqued my interest, so bought it. What you may like: 1. Nice material, soft on the inside 2. The material is thick and appears to be good quality 3. Has an inner lining that is removable 4. Has a hood that is removable 5. Very warm. I used it in Toronto last week of Dec 2017 where it was -31F and it kept me warm. When I got back to Vancouver, where it is milder, I removed the inner lining and it kept me warm without me sweating inside. 6. Has lots of pockets, with some pockets inside the jacket as well 7. Good fit, the measurements are accurate (maybe a tiny bit on the cozy side with the inner lining) 8. Simple design that looks good. 9. At a $117 (at the time of the review), it is good value What you may not like 1. I personally prefer a zipper pocket on the top part of the jacket for easy access to a cell phone, and this one doesn't have one (it has one inside). It has a buttoned pocket. Minor, but it might be annoying for some. 2. The inside pocket zipper is small and can be sticky ... show more

This would have been perfect when I was a bit bigger. I'm closer to average build now, but my shoulders are still a little broad. The XL fits perfect in the shoulders but its pretty baggy around the midsection. There's a drawstring to help adjust for that, but it can only do so much. This is a layering jacket. This is not meant to be your only defense against the elements. It's not going to block heavy rain. It's not going to block frigid winds. It blocks wind much better than some of these reviews suggest, in my opinion, but it's not a windbreaker, nor does it make the horrific sound that those polyester windbreakers/puffer jackets make. This jacket, over a hoodie, over a flannel, over a t shirt, will get you through an hour outside shoveling the drive at 0F. That's what I wanted it to do, and it does that quite well. ... show more

The material is soft and it is WARM. I used the liner for a week or so of temps in the teens, but have since taken it out and the coat is plenty warm for ~30º mornings. It's also a great looking coat. It's not perfect. There are some cons. Two of the three chest pockets are fake. One is a zipper that goes nowhere and the other is just a side-facing flap, albeit with a little dangly loop that could be used for keys or lift passes or the like (but there's no pocket behind that flap to stash it in). Not a big deal but I'm a bit of a pocket addict so it was disappointing. Now I have fewer places to stick items and forget about them for years. The liner also stank when I received the coat. I'm not sure what the smell was but 10 minutes or so in the dryer aired it out nicely. Oh yeah, and the zipper is backwards, like women's zippers, but it's a nice metal zipper that I think will last at least long-enough for me to figure out how to use it without cursing. None of these things really detract from the overall greatness of the coat, though. It's just something to be prepared for. The company is also superb. The sizing, at least at the time I purchased it, was WAY off. I took my measurements and matched it up to the provided chart. I came in just at the top end of one of the sizes so I ordered the next size up to be safe. A representative from the company sent me an email asking me for my measurements and they wound up recommending the size above the size I'd chosen. I accepted their recommendation and am happy I did. It would have been a very snug fit otherwise. So when you order it, watch for that email and send them your numbers. Buy the coat. You won't regret it. ... show more
